Search: 1504952
3 products matching "1504952"
Showing 1-3 of 3 products
0332204202
BOSCH OEM 24V/20A 5 PIN RELAY
4528020090
Duomatic
TRM018
12V 30/40A MINI RELAY CHANGE OVER WITH BRACKET